Keys with a chip transponder
Back in the day, if you lost your car key, you could take it to a local locksmith or hardware store to have a replacement cut. You'd get a standard metal key with a plastic top that housed the transponder chip. The chip transmits an electronic signal to the car when you turn the key into the ignition. The computer in the car will then look up this serial number to unlock it or start it. If the computer can't find the code, it will not start your car, and you won't be able to drive away.
If your car key has a chip on it, you'll be able to tell because the key is thicker than a traditional key. It may also sport a grey or black head. It can be integrated with a remote or remain in your purse, pocket or bag and feature a push button to start your car. This kind of key can be made to work with most cars, but they must be programmed to match the system of your vehicle.
Keys with chips cost more than regular keys however they are more secure against theft. Locksmiths require specialized equipment to clone keys with chip technology and also a functioning key from your car. This kind of key could still be tampered with. You should lock your doors and close all windows prior to leaving your vehicle.
A key equipped with chip transponders is an electronic microchip built into the head. This is why they are often referred to as "chip" or "transponder" keys. The vehicle manufacturer programs the chips with a specific code. When the key is put into the ignition, a transmitter in the antenna ring sends out an impulsive radio frequency energy. The transponder chip absorbs this energy and sends out the signal with its identification code to the receiver in the ignition.
This information is then processed by the vehicle's computer to ensure that only an authentic key is being used. Your car will not start when the code on the transponder is not in line with the code in your ECM. This technology was created to stop auto theft by making it difficult for thieves to duplicate or copy your car's key.
Keys without transponder chips
When you lose your car key it could be a major hassle. It could take a long time to locate a replacement key and program it. It is much simpler if you have a spare key. Finding someone who can cut a key with the correct code is difficult especially for modern vehicles. Most modern keys contain an electronic chip that communicates with your car to stop theft. These chips require specialized equipment that only a dealership can utilize, which is why many customers visit the dealer when they lose their car keys.
Determine what type of key you need. Certain older models still have mechanical keys, while others utilize transponder chips. The latter are designed to guard against theft by connecting to the vehicle's computer and verifying that it is a genuine key. They are also more difficult to duplicate as they are laser-cut and cannot be easily copied with an ordinary grinder. Some vehicles have smart-keys that function as a remote control but does not require turning the ignition.
Most hardware stores will produce copies of your mechanical key. The process is relatively cheap and the final product will function exactly like the original. You'll need to bring your vehicle's VIN number and working key to the store, which will enable them to trace the exact contours of the blank key. Some stores even have a machine that can read the information from the immobilizer to ensure that the new key will work with your vehicle.
If you have transponder keys this process is more complex. The keys must be programmed to function and the chip needs to be compatible with the codes that your car uses. This is a security feature that can in preventing theft. Your vehicle will usually not start when the chip isn't properly matched. This is why it is important to always have a spare key at your side.

Keys for a keyless entry system
New vehicles are increasingly fitted with proximity keys and keyless entry. These new technologies are complex and should be handled by an expert. A locksmith can help you to understand how these systems function and how they can help you save money in the future. A locksmith can also program or fix your proximity key. This will save you time and money.
The first step in changing your car key cutting near me key to determine what type you have. Older models of cars only require a standard cut keys but modern cars include transponder chips that must be programmed. This can be done by a dealer or through an automotive locksmith. You can also save money by making an extra 24 hour key cutting on your own and programming it. This is possible with many automakers, but you must follow the guidelines in your owner's guide.
Another option is to visit the hardware store or big box retailer. Some of these stores have key-cutting machines which can replicate a standard key in minutes. Just be sure to choose a blank key that fits the thickness of the original key. Try a kiosk that cuts keys, like KeyMe, if you want to cut down on time. The service is available in many cities and cuts the most commonly used keys at the kiosk.
Consider having the key fob reprogrammed if you are purchasing a used vehicle. This will erase previous owner information from the vehicle's database. This will stop thieves from using the device that is able to capture and transmit the signals to the keyfob. Relay crimes are on the rise and it's possible that the key fob that was stolen could be used to start the engine in a different car.
